The Misericordia University men's lacrosse team fell 16-5 to Lycoming on the road Thursday afternoon despite a four-goal performance by top scorer Sean McGuigan.
McGuigan scored the Cougars' lone goal of the first half--a score that tied the game 1-1 at 6:47 in the first period. The team faced a 10-1 deficit at halftime.
The team scored four in the second half but trailed by as much as 12 points. They were outshot in the game 46-20.
McGuigan's four goals led the team and put him at 23 for the season. Dan Rafferty notched a goal and an assist, and Lee Blair added an assist.
The Cougars (3-8, 1-5) travel to Manhattanville on April 15.
